Output 389698d1cc504dfd23e781eda46f463804c8f34931b74c45c4f71d99a44e6af9:1

value
6905279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374edc2f2cd5edd4e95ab13e91586857c11b9 OP_EQUAL
address
3BMEXMhYBWz7vf8kQKRfZN9554A2BrWeaj
transaction
389698d1cc504dfd23e781eda46f463804c8f34931b74c45c4f71d99a44e6af9
spent
true